RAN as a Sensor (RANaaS)
Radio Access Network Cellular Radar Sensing Service Monetization
Commercial business model allowing third-party developers to purchase real-time environmental radar sensing data directly from cell towers.
Technical Explanation
Because 6G cell towers natively emit radar sensing waveforms, telecom operators transform from mere data bit conduits into real-time environmental sensor providers. Through standardized open APIs (such as GSMA Open Gateway), third-party developers, meteorologists, autonomous vehicle fleets, and logistics companies can query cell towers for real-time precipitation mapping, street traffic density, drone intrusion alerts, and pedestrian foot-traffic analytics.
Key Functions
- Monetizes cellular radio wave echoes as high-resolution radar sensing services
- Provides open APIs for third-party drone tracking, weather sensing, and traffic monitoring
- Transforms passive cell tower assets into active spatial intelligence infrastructure
- Shields user identities while providing aggregate spatial environmental analytics
Specifications
GSMA Open Gateway Sensing APIs, 3GPP TR 22.837 Sensing Services, ITU-R M.2160
